Hi I recently sold some items on ebay and my buyers have used paypal to pay me. When I looked at the transactions on my paypal account, it looks like I have been charged a fee to receive the payments?? WHy is this? I have not noticed this before? Can anyone explain? Thanks

You pay ebay to advertise and sell your items.
You pay paypal to be able to receive all card-funded payments from buyers.
Paypal are not a "free/charity" service I'm afraid.
But if you could not receive card funded payments via paypal it is doubtful many buyers would bother to buy as they would have no paypal buyer protection.
